The Itinerary in Detail
.jpg)
Pickup and Transfer
The journey kicks off with hotel pickups from Ao Nang, Krabi Town, or nearby areas. This convenience means you won’t have to worry about transportation logistics, and the entire process is streamlined to maximize your time on the water.
Starting at Ao Thalane
Once at Ao Thalane, the group gathers for a brief safety and paddle technique session. The guides, who are quite experienced, often include insights into the local ecosystem, making the trip both fun and educational.

Limestone Canyons and Hidden Waterways
Moving into a limestone canyon area, you’ll find high cliffs framing still, glassy waters. This part offers some of the most striking views, with reviewers noting “breathtaking scenery” and “perfect photo stops.” The calm waters and shaded routes make paddling easy, even for novices.
Wildlife and Nature
Guides are generally knowledgeable about the local wildlife, and you’ll find plenty of chances to see mudskippers, birds, and monkeys. Several reviewers mention how close they felt to nature, especially during the quiet moments in the limestone canyons.
Relaxation and Photo Opportunities
Throughout the trip, there are designated stops for photos and relaxing in the natural surroundings. These moments are cherished by travelers, who often mention the beautiful vistas and tranquil ambiance as highlights.
End of Tour and Return
After about two hours of paddling, the guide will lead you back to the starting point. You’ll then be transferred back to Ao Nang, with plenty of time left in your day for other activities or a relaxing evening.
What to Expect on the Water

Expect calm, shaded routes ideal for a leisurely paddle. The kayaks are suitable for beginners, and the guides are attentive, ensuring everyone feels comfortable. The waterways are generally shallow, with the opportunity to see marine and terrestrial wildlife up close.
Some reviewers have mentioned that the guides are friendly and knowledgeable, often sharing interesting facts about the ecosystem. You might find the paddle length perfect for a short, manageable trip, but those seeking a more intense workout might feel it’s too relaxed.
Practical Details
.jpg)
Duration and Schedule
The tour lasts approximately four hours, including pickup, paddling, and return. Starting times vary depending on your hotel pickup, but most are scheduled to maximize daylight and weather conditions.
Price and Value
While the exact cost isn’t specified here, this tour provides a good value considering the conveniences—hotel pickup, guiding, equipment, and the scenic experience. It’s an affordable way to enjoy a nature escape without the costs or commitments of full-day trips.
What to Bring
Remember to pack swimwear, a towel, and sunscreen. Since the routes are shaded, sun protection is still advisable, especially if you tend to burn easily or plan to stay in the sun during breaks.
Not Suitable For
This tour isn’t recommended for pregnant women or wheelchair users due to the physical nature of paddling and accessibility considerations.
